Autonomous driving is still plagued by threats from various attacks, which can be divided into physical attacks, network attacks, and learning-based adversarial attacks. Inevitably, the safety & security of autonomous driving systems based on deep learning are seriously challenged by these attacks, so countermeasures should be studied to mitigate potential risks.
